The flag bearer of the New Patriotic Party (NPP), Nana Akufo Addo is likely to name his running mate by next week.
That would put to rest all the speculations about who will be the vice presidential candidate of the NPP.
Nana Addo who is currently in the United Kingdom is expected in the country on Tuesday, March 11, 2008 and will also be expected to unveil his campaign team for the December elections.
A leading member of the yet to be named campaign team, Dr. Arthur Kennedy told Joy News that an aggressive campaign message was being drawn for the NPP flag bearer.
He said the message was channeled towards enabling Nana Addo win the December elections.
Dr. Kennedy stressed that the campaign team would not be relying solely on President Kufuor’s achievements.
He noted the team would be emphasising the track record of Nana Addo.
According to him, the NPP presidential candidate who is also the Member of Parliament for Abuakwa South had performed creditably as Foreign Minister.
